Functions of Production Management
Planning
Planning is essential as it sets the foundation for all production activities by determining the objectives and strategies needed to meet production goals.
- Demand Forecasting: Involves predicting future product demand using historical data, market trends, and other factors. Accurate demand forecasting ensures that production meets customer needs without excessive inventory.
- Capacity Planning: This step assesses whether the organization has the necessary resources, such as equipment, labor, and facilities, to meet anticipated demand. Proper capacity planning avoids underutilization or overburdening of resources.
- Production Planning: Develops a detailed roadmap for production activities, including schedules, sequence of operations, and resource allocation. Effective production planning ensures timely and cost-effective production.
Organizing
Organizing arranges resources and activities to efficiently achieve production goals.
- Resource Allocation: Involves assigning the necessary human resources, equipment, materials, and finances to specific tasks. Efficient resource allocation ensures that each task has the needed resources.
- Workflow Design: Structures the flow of work to minimize delays, reduce idle time, and enhance productivity. Good workflow design helps in identifying and eliminating bottlenecks.
- Establishing Roles and Responsibilities: Clearly defining roles and responsibilities within the production team promotes accountability and efficiency.
Directing
Directing oversees and guides production activities to ensure they are carried out effectively.
- Leadership and Motivation: Effective leaders motivate production teams, fostering a positive work environment that enhances productivity.
- Coordination: Ensures seamless communication and collaboration among departments and teams, facilitating smooth operations.
- Supervision: Involves monitoring production activities, resolving issues, and ensuring compliance with quality and safety standards.
Controlling
Controlling monitors production performance and ensures that it aligns with planned objectives, taking corrective actions when necessary.
- Performance Measurement: Uses key performance indicators (KPIs) to assess efficiency, quality, and adherence to schedules. This helps in identifying areas for improvement.
- Quality Control: Implements processes to maintain product quality throughout production. This ensures that products meet required standards and specifications.
- Cost Control: Monitors and manages production costs, identifies cost-saving opportunities, and ensures that spending remains within budget.
Coordinating
Coordinating harmonizes various production activities and resources for seamless operations.
- Supply Chain Management: Ensures timely delivery of materials and components by coordinating with suppliers and logistics partners.
- Production Scheduling: Develops detailed schedules for production activities, ensuring optimal use of resources and meeting customer demand.
- Inventory Management: Balances inventory levels to meet production needs while minimizing carrying costs and avoiding stockouts.
Improving
Improving focuses on continuous enhancement of processes, systems, and performance.
- Kaizen and Lean Principles: These methodologies aim to eliminate waste, improve efficiency, and enhance quality. Continuous improvement practices ensure that production processes remain competitive.
- Innovation: Encourages the adoption of new technologies and processes to stay ahead of market trends and meet evolving customer needs.
- Feedback and Learning: Collects and analyzes performance data and stakeholder feedback to implement improvements. This fosters a culture of ongoing development and refinement.
Maintenance Management
Maintenance Management ensures the reliability and optimal performance of production equipment and facilities.
- Preventive Maintenance: Schedules regular inspections and maintenance tasks to prevent unexpected equipment failures and downtime.
- Predictive Maintenance: Uses data analytics and sensors to predict potential equipment issues and schedule maintenance proactively, thereby reducing unplanned downtime.
- Asset Management: Focuses on optimizing the lifecycle of production assets through effective maintenance and strategic investments in new technologies.
Safety and Environmental Management
Safety and Environmental Management prioritizes creating a safe and sustainable work environment.
- Safety Standards: Implements safety protocols, training programs, and risk assessments to protect employees and ensure compliance with regulatory requirements.
- Environmental Sustainability: Adopts practices that minimize environmental impact, such as energy efficiency measures, waste reduction, and recycling initiatives.
- Compliance: Ensures adherence to environmental regulations and standards governing production processes and emissions, promoting sustainable and responsible production.
By effectively managing these functions, organizations can optimize their production processes, ensuring high-quality output, cost efficiency, and sustainability.
